photo_timescale

sbpy.activity.gas.core.photo_timescale(species=None, source=None)[source]

Photodissociation timescale for a gas species.

Parameters:
speciesstring, optional

Species to look up or None to show a list of all species and sources.

sourcestring, optional

Retrieve values from this source or None to show a list of all sources for given species.

Returns:
tauQuantity or None

The timescale at 1 au. May be a two-element array: (quiet Sun, active Sun). None is returned if species or source is None.

Examples

>>> from sbpy.activity import photo_timescale
>>> tau = photo_timescale("OH", "CS93")
